2
Project Objectives
  • Based on high incidence of pathogen occurrence in
    Rio Grande and irrigation canals (eg., Morales et
    al. 2006), effectiveness of local wastewater
    treatment plants was questioned.
  • Recently developed methods (Morales et al. 2003)
    allow for quantification of protozoa, bacteria
    and virus.

Methods
  • One liter sampled from Influent, Ten liters of
    Effluent sampled.
  • Protozoa.
  • Giardia and Cryptosporidium quantified by EPA
    Method 1623,
  • with a Immunomagnetic Separation (IMS)
    purification step.
  • Bacteria.
  • Helicobacter pylori. Quantified by selective
    medium containing
  • 5 antibiotics and 2 antifungal agents (Morales
    and Vidal).
  • Fecal coliforms by Standard Method 9222 D.
  • Virus. E. coli phage and Pseudomonas phage by
    EPA method 1602.

Log ReductionsHow well does a treatment plant
reduce the levels of pathogens?
Eg. Influent Effluent Log Reduction Plant
A 10,000 10 log(10,000/10) 3
(one-thousand-fold lower) Eliminated 99.9
of influent Plant B 10,000 1000 log(10,000/100
0) 1 (ten-fold lower)
Eliminated only 90 of influent

Conclusions
  • Las Cruces, NM and El Paso, TX wastewater
    treatment plants functioned properly over the
    2-year study.
  • The Ciudad Juarez Planta Norte functioned in
    reducing putative Helicobacter pylori, but had
    little or no effect on fecal coliforms, and
    coliphages. On average, protozoa were reduced by
    1 log (90 reduction).
